2. Use The Correct Packing Materials

The best way to protect your fragile possessions is to use effective packing materials. Try not to scrimp or substitute protective packing materials as your alternative options may not quite be as effective, nor have adequate cushioning to provide enough protection from breakage or damage during transit.

Before you start packing, be sure to grab effective packing materials such as:

  • Strong, purpose-made reinforced moving boxes
  • Packing peanuts
  • Bubble wrap
  • Packing paper
  • Dish and glass packers
  • Markers for labelling boxes
  • Strong packing tape
  • Moving blankets

 


3. Pack Fragile Items The Right Way

Giffen Furniture Removal Pack Fragile Items The Right Way

When it comes to packing fragile items, certain techniques work better for specific objects. Below are some common fragile items and how to best pack them:

  • Plates – plates should be individually wrapped in bubble wrap and then stacked inside a box that’s just slightly larger. Before adding your plates, the box should be first lined with crumpled packing paper to line the box before the dishes are then stacked on top.
  • Glasses – use cardboard dividers to separate glassware to minimise movement and bumps. Just like with plates, glasses should be wrapped individually. Roll each glass in a sheet of packing paper and then and then pack the empty space inside with crumpled paper.
  • Picture Frames – wrap smaller frames individually with packing paper before placing them into moving boxes that have been padded out with packing peanuts or bubble wrap. When it comes to significantly larger frames, wrap them in moving blankets and secure the blankets with packing tape. Position large frames in the moving truck so that they sit upright (rather than flat) in order to prevent the glass from cracking.

 

 


4. Label Your Fragile Items

Ensure that your fragile items are clearly labelled “FRAGILE” to instruct anyone who is handling your belongings that they should be gently handled with care. Use a thick marker so that your labelling is easy to read and clearly visible.

 

 


5. Don’t Overload Moving Boxes

Incorrectly packing too many fragile items into one box can add too much weight – and result in the bottom of your box falling out and damaging your precious items.

To prevent damaging your fragile items, be sure to have enough moving boxes on hand so you won’t have to overpack. Pad out any empty spaces with packing peanuts and ensure your fragile items are individually wrapped when combining them into a single box.
